Abstract

PURPOSE: To contemplate complete recovery of tar and to make it possible to separate high-caloric gas and low-caloricgas from each other and to recover them, by dry distilling and gasifying coal by using a multi-stage shaft furnace in which each furnace in each stage is connected through each throat part to each other.
CONSTITUTION: Each of throat 5W7 having a narrow inside diameter is provided between adjacent furnaces in stages 1W4. Raw coal is introduced from a coal-charging port 8 provided at the top of a furnace in the highest stage 4 into the furnace. Oxygen and steam are introduced from a supply port 9 provided at the lower part of a furnace in the lowest stage 1 into the furnace. There are provided conduit pipes 10W12 projecting from each furnace toward outside and laying across the adjacent furnaces in each of the stages 1W4. A branch pipe is provided above the furnace in the highest stage 4. Produced gas is recovered from the branch pipe. Temperature control in each stage is carried out by externally cooling each furnace with gas. The amount of gas in each stage can be controlled by adjusting the amount of gas to be drawn out.
